The FAW 12m³ Dust Suppression Truck emerges as a powerful assistant to protect clean environments. Equipped with a Euro VI FAW Dachai 220HP diesel engine and an 8-speed transmission, this truck delivers robust power and tackles complex road conditions with ease.
Its 8T rear axle and 10.00R20 steel wire tires ensure exceptional load-bearing capacity, while features like power steering and air brakes balance driving comfort and safety. The tank, constructed from high-quality Wugang carbon steel with anti-rust and anti-corrosion treatments, supports multiple water inlet methods (self-priming, fire hydrant interface) to ensure continuous operation.
The truck’s performance stands out with a mist cannon range of over 60 meters horizontally and 20 meters vertically. Secondary atomization technology reduces water droplets to 50-150μm, significantly increasing dust contact area and suppressing dust with 95% sedimentation efficiency. It also saves 70-80% water compared to similar equipment, embodying energy and environmental efficiency.
For operational convenience, the FAW 12m³ supports dual control modes (remote and manual), allowing flexible adjustment of spray angles from inside or outside the cab.
